Qualified teams' seedings

Quarter-finalists are paired according to their positions in the groups: the first-place team in each preliminary-round group plays the fourth-place team of the other group, while the second-place team plays the third-place team of the other group.[2]

Semi-finalists are paired according to their seeding after the preliminary round, which is determined by the following criteria. The best-ranked semi-finalist plays against the lowest-ranked semi-finalist, while the second-best ranked semi-finalist plays the third-best ranked semi-finalist.[2]

Classification rules: 1) position in the group; 2) number of points; 3) goal difference; 4) number of goals scored for; 5) seeding number entering the tournament.[2]
